Panic Attack, Should I Be Worried ?

I had an argument with my boyfriend and went to lie down but was still very upset about it, all of a sudden, I started to feel some shortness of breath (not a lot)... my heart also started beating louder and I would feel my heart drop ... my heart beat was regular other than those episodes where I felt like my heart dropped in its chest. Everytime I managed to think of something else, I wouldn t experience this, when I got nervous about my heart, I started having this symptoms all over again... Has anyone experienced this ? Should I be worried ? I am planning on seeing my doctor, I ve never experienced something like this and it has gone away.

You might not necessarily be having an all-out panic attack, but you certainly are experiencing panic-like symptoms. I have panic disorder and I experience those symptoms plus a few when I have panic attacks. My doctor told me that you can experience the symptoms without having a panic attack. I would suggest you see an M.D. and have him check you out. It might be your heart, but if it isn't and you are having panic attacks he can send you to a shrink. Either way, you should really get checked out. You really don't want it to be your heart OR panic attacks.. but its certainly important to get either checked out.
